    Warford is ok, but I'd rather have Winters. Warford is so damn big, I think he's really going to have trouble in pass protection. Couple that with the fact that Detroit basically runs a shotgun, spread offense, and he'll really be in trouble on an island out there by himself. I think Winters is the more complete player. Jets got a good one there IMO.
